Merchant's Valley, also know as Trader's Valley, or the Wideway is one of the five passes that cross the Dragonspine mountains (see UW2 for more on this). It is the broadest and easiest to travel, but caravans area at risk both from chaos erupting from the Hollow and raiders from the Wintertop and the Bush Range or the Stinking Forest.

> What kind of people live there? Tarshite settlers?
Settlement here would be very dangerous due to the proximity to the Hollow. It is also forbidden by the Dwarf.

>What is Too Far? a fort? a town? is the valley part of the kingdom
of Tarsh?
A shabby little stop on the main trade route between Tarsh and Aldachur. Better than sleeping out in the open here, but perhaps only just.

Its both beyond the glowline and the present Tarshite border (though Tarsh has in the past ruled all of human settled Dragon Pass - the first king of the Quivini was Yarandros not Sartar).
